查找系统开发工具名称的方法包括:在线搜索、开发者论坛、技术文档、同事或行业专家咨询。其中,在线搜索是最直接和高效的方法。通过输入相关关键词,如“系统开发工具”、“软件开发工具”等,可以迅速找到当前流行的开发工具以及它们的功能、用户评价和使用教程。通过在线搜索,你不仅可以获得最新的市场动向,还能阅读用户的真实反馈,帮助你做出更明智的选择。
一、在线搜索
在线搜索是查找系统开发工具名称最直接的方式。你可以使用搜索引擎,如Google、Bing等,通过输入相关关键词快速找到所需信息。以下是一些常用的搜索技巧和策略:
1.1 使用关键词
使用具体的关键词进行搜索,可以提高搜索结果的准确性。例如,输入“Java系统开发工具”、“Python IDE”等特定语言或框架的关键词,可以快速定位到相关工具。
1.2 阅读博客和评测文章
很多技术博客和网站会对各种开发工具进行评测和比较。这些文章通常会详细介绍工具的优缺点、使用场景和用户体验。例如,Medium、Dev.to等平台上有大量开发者分享的经验和见解。
1.3 官方网站和文档
开发工具的官方网站通常会提供详细的功能介绍、使用教程和下载链接。通过访问这些网站,你可以获取最权威和全面的信息。例如,Visual Studio、Eclipse等工具都有非常详细的官方网站。
二、开发者论坛
开发者论坛是获取开发工具信息的另一个重要渠道。在这些论坛上,你可以与其他开发者交流经验、获取建议和解决问题。以下是一些常见的开发者论坛:
2.1 Stack Overflow
Stack Overflow是全球最大的开发者问答社区。你可以在这里搜索相关问题,查看其他开发者的回答和建议。很多开发工具都有专门的标签和讨论区。
2.2 GitHub
GitHub不仅是一个代码托管平台,还是一个开发者社区。你可以在GitHub上搜索开源项目,查看项目使用的工具和技术栈,阅读项目文档和讨论。
2.3 Reddit
Reddit上有许多与开发相关的子版块(subreddits),如r/programming、r/learnprogramming等。在这些版块中,你可以找到关于开发工具的讨论和推荐。
三、技术文档
技术文档是了解开发工具功能和使用方法的重要资源。很多开发工具都有详细的官方文档,你可以通过阅读这些文档深入了解工具的特性和使用方法。
3.1 官方文档
大多数开发工具都有官方文档,提供详细的安装、配置和使用指南。例如,Visual Studio、Eclipse等IDE都有非常详细的官方文档,涵盖从入门到高级使用的各个方面。
3.2 在线教程
很多在线教育平台和技术博客会提供开发工具的使用教程。这些教程通常包括视频、文字和示例代码,帮助你快速上手工具。例如,Coursera、Udemy等平台上有大量关于开发工具的课程。
四、同事或行业专家咨询
向有经验的同事或行业专家咨询也是查找开发工具名称的有效方法。通过与他们交流,你可以获取第一手的经验和建议,避免走弯路。
4.1 内部交流
在公司内部,你可以与有经验的同事交流,了解他们使用的开发工具和经验。很多公司都有内部的技术交流会或知识分享会,你可以通过参加这些活动获取信息。
4.2 行业会议和研讨会
参加行业会议和研讨会也是获取开发工具信息的好机会。在这些活动中,你可以与行业专家交流,了解最新的工具和技术趋势。例如,各类技术大会、开发者大会等都是很好的信息来源。
五、开发工具的分类和选择
在了解了查找开发工具的方法后,接下来我们来看看不同类型的开发工具,以及如何根据需求选择合适的工具。
5.1 集成开发环境(IDE)
IDE是开发过程中最常用的工具之一,提供了代码编辑、调试、编译等一站式服务。常见的IDE有:
- Visual Studio:适用于C#、C++、Python等多种语言,功能强大,适合大型项目。
- Eclipse:广泛用于Java开发,插件丰富,适合多种开发场景。
- PyCharm:专为Python开发设计,提供智能代码补全、调试等功能。
5.2 代码编辑器
代码编辑器是轻量级的开发工具,适合快速编辑和调试代码。常见的代码编辑器有:
- Visual Studio Code:支持多种编程语言,插件丰富,广泛用于Web开发。
- Sublime Text:轻量级,启动快,支持多种编程语言和插件。
- Atom:由GitHub开发,支持多种编程语言和插件,界面友好。
5.3 版本控制工具
版本控制工具用于管理代码版本和协作开发,常见的版本控制工具有:
- Git:分布式版本控制系统,广泛用于开源项目和企业开发。
- Subversion(SVN):集中式版本控制系统,适用于传统企业开发。
5.4 项目管理工具
项目管理工具用于计划、跟踪和管理开发项目,常见的项目管理工具有:
- Jira:功能强大,适用于敏捷开发和项目管理。
- Trello:界面简洁,适用于小型团队和个人项目管理。
- Asana:适用于任务管理和团队协作。
六、开发工具的评价和选择标准
在选择开发工具时,需要综合考虑多方面的因素,包括功能、性能、易用性、社区支持等。以下是一些评价和选择开发工具的标准:
6.1 功能
开发工具的功能是选择的重要标准之一。一个好的开发工具应该提供丰富的功能,满足开发过程中的各种需求。例如,IDE应该提供代码编辑、调试、编译等一站式服务,版本控制工具应该支持分支管理、冲突解决等功能。
6.2 性能
开发工具的性能直接影响开发效率。一个高效的工具应该启动快、响应快,能够处理大规模项目而不出现卡顿。例如,代码编辑器应该能够快速打开和编辑大文件,IDE应该能够高效编译和调试代码。
6.3 易用性
开发工具的易用性也是选择的重要标准。一个友好的工具应该界面简洁、操作方便,易于上手。例如,代码编辑器应该提供智能代码补全、语法高亮等功能,IDE应该提供可视化调试、代码导航等功能。
6.4 社区支持
社区支持是评估开发工具的重要因素。一个有活跃社区支持的工具,能够及时获取问题的解决方案,获取最新的插件和扩展。例如,GitHub上有大量开源项目和插件,Stack Overflow上有大量开发者的问答。
七、开发工具的实践与应用
了解了开发工具的选择标准后,接下来我们来看看如何在实际开发中应用这些工具。
7.1 代码编辑和调试
在代码编辑和调试过程中,选择合适的代码编辑器和IDE非常重要。例如,在Web开发中,可以选择Visual Studio Code,提供丰富的插件和调试功能;在Java开发中,可以选择Eclipse,提供强大的代码补全和调试功能。
7.2 版本控制和协作开发
在版本控制和协作开发中,选择合适的版本控制工具和项目管理工具非常重要。例如,可以选择Git进行分布式版本控制,使用GitHub进行代码托管和协作开发;可以选择Jira进行项目管理和任务跟踪,使用Trello进行任务管理和团队协作。
7.3 自动化构建和部署
在自动化构建和部署过程中,选择合适的构建工具和部署工具非常重要。例如,可以选择Maven进行Java项目的构建和依赖管理,使用Jenkins进行持续集成和部署;可以选择Docker进行容器化部署,使用Kubernetes进行容器编排和管理。
八、总结
查找系统开发工具名称的方法包括在线搜索、开发者论坛、技术文档、同事或行业专家咨询。这些方法可以帮助你快速获取开发工具的信息和建议。在选择开发工具时,需要综合考虑功能、性能、易用性、社区支持等因素。在实际开发中,选择合适的代码编辑器、IDE、版本控制工具、项目管理工具和构建部署工具,可以提高开发效率和项目质量。
通过以上内容的详细介绍,相信你已经对查找系统开发工具名称的方法和选择标准有了全面的了解。在实际开发中,可以根据具体需求和项目特点,选择合适的开发工具,提高开发效率和项目质量。
相关问答FAQs:
1. 为什么我需要查找系统开发工具的名称?
查找系统开发工具的名称可以帮助您了解有哪些工具可用于开发您的系统。这样您就可以选择最适合您项目需求的工具。
2. 在哪里可以找到系统开发工具的名称?
您可以通过搜索引擎,如Google或百度,来查找系统开发工具的名称。此外,您还可以参考技术论坛、开发者社区或专业网站,了解其他开发人员推荐的工具。
3. 如何选择适合我的项目的系统开发工具?
选择适合您项目的系统开发工具需要考虑多个因素,如项目的规模、技术要求和开发团队的经验水平。您可以先了解每个工具的特点和功能,然后根据您的项目需求进行比较和评估。您还可以尝试使用一些工具的免费试用版或开源版本,来判断它们是否符合您的预期。